Maven是一个Java项目管理工具,可以帮助开发人员自动化构建、依赖管理和项目部署等任务。在使用Maven时,有时可能会遇到无法为父项目生成JAR文件的问题。以下是一些可能导致该问题的原因和解决方法:
<packaging>jar</packaging>
<build>
<plugins>
<plugin>
<groupId>org.apache.maven.plugins</groupId>
<artifactId>maven-jar-plugin</artifactId>
<version>3.2.0</version>
<configuration>
<archive>
<manifest>
<addClasspath>true</addClasspath>
<classpathPrefix>lib/</classpathPrefix>
<mainClass>com.example.MainClass</mainClass>
</manifest>
</archive>
</configuration>
</plugin>
</plugins>
</build>
mvn dependency:tree
命令查看项目的依赖树,以确保所有依赖项都正确解析。mvn clean
命令清理项目,并使用mvn package
命令重新构建项目。如果上述方法都无法解决问题,可以尝试在Maven官方网站或相关论坛上搜索类似的问题,或者向Maven社区寻求帮助。另外,腾讯云提供了一系列与云计算相关的产品,如云服务器、云数据库、云存储等,可以根据具体需求选择适合的产品。具体产品介绍和相关链接可以在腾讯云官方网站上找到。
领取专属 10元无门槛券
手把手带您无忧上云